This is pretty much what I’ve been doing this past week: making skirts out of bright tank tops that I never wear. I’ve really been wanting to color block an outfit but I realized I don’t have a lot of color in my closet. Anyway its a super easy DIY all you basically have to do is cut under the arms and add elastic into the hem (:
